  • If you SSH into the firewall, press 5 for Device Management and then 3 for Advanced Shell.

    /var/tslog/awarrenmta.log contains all the MTA Mode logging.

    If your firewall rules are correct, then you can help diagnose the problem with your MTA Mode configuration using this log file.

    The Web Interface is good for showing you information when MTA Mode is properly configured, but very useless for helping you diagnose a misconfiguration.

  • Viewing files using cat and more and filtering them with grep and awk won't modify the configuration of the firewall.

    It's when you start editing configuration files using the Advanced Shell that voids your support contract.

    Remote support is a good option, but if you are comfortable using a shell on a Linux system and know what commands will and won't modify configuration files then you won't have any problems with support. Worst case is that you have to factory reset the firewall or perform a USB firmware upgrade to get it back to a known good state.
